Umpire Equipment and Uniform

The proper uniform for FGSL umpires include the following:

  • Grey or Navy Blue pants (worn over your shin guards)
  • Powder blue FGSL shirt issued by the league (worn over your chest protector)
  • Black shoes, socks, and belt.
  • Optional FGSL Umpire hat (available to purchase). USA Softball certified umpires may wear an ASA/USA Softball hat.

Umpire equipment:

All plate umpires must be properly equipped before stepping on the field for a game. This is for your safety. Equipment includes:

Safety Equipment

  • Mask
  • Chest Protector (worn under your shirt)
  • Shin Guards (worn under your pants)
  • Cup for male umpires
  • Optional: Umpire plate shoes (not provided by the league)

Other necessary equipment

  • Indicator (held in left hand)
  • Ball bag (worn on belt)
  • Plate brush (kept in ball bag or pocket)
  • Timer devise
